What is Part B PROCEDURAL SAFEGUARDS NOTICE?
Part B Procedural Safeguards Notice is a document provided to parents of children with disabilities that outlines their rights under the Individuals with Disabilities Education Act (IDEA). It details the procedures and protections available to ensure that children receive appropriate educational services.
Who is required to file Part B PROCEDURAL SAFEGUARDS NOTICE?
The Part B Procedural Safeguards Notice must be provided by the local education agency (LEA) to parents of eligible children with disabilities when they are initially referred for assessment, when they are being evaluated for special education services, and at other key points throughout the special education process.

What is the purpose of Part B PROCEDURAL SAFEGUARDS NOTICE?
The purpose of the Part B Procedural Safeguards Notice is to inform parents of their rights regarding the identification, evaluation, placement, and provision of free appropriate public education (FAPE) for their children with disabilities, thereby enhancing parental involvement in the educational process.
What information must be reported on Part B PROCEDURAL SAFEGUARDS NOTICE?
The Part B Procedural Safeguards Notice must report information such as the child's educational rights, procedures for resolving disputes, timelines for services, the evaluation and eligibility process, and other important aspects related to the special education services provided under IDEA.
